Look at:

Admin>Comment Management. This will let you delete comments

Admin>Configure>Comments. If you set Number of comments(sidebar) to 0, the comments may not show up in the sidebar. Have not tested this particular setting - let me know if it works.

Not sure if there is an easy way to turn on/off comments.
